Easy to transport The electric chair offers many advantages, especially in situations where you have to cover long distances on public transportation or long distances. It is a fantastic option for those who want to be active and independent. However, the heavy weight and large size of traditional powered wheelchairs can make them difficult to transport and store. This is the reason why modern technology has allowed manufacturers to create portable electric wheelchairs that are light and compact. These models are light, easy to transport, and can be disassembled and folded to store. They can also fit into the trunk of a car, or be carried on an aircraft. Comparatively to other models this wheelchair is extremely easy to maintain. You can clean it with water and soap, or you can use a stronger chemical cleaner specifically designed for wheelchairs. Follow the instructions of the manufacturer to keep your wheelchair in good shape. Another crucial aspect of maintaining your wheelchair is to inspect the alignment on a regular basis. This is crucial whether you have a wheelchair that is self-propelled or one that requires an attendant to drive. If you notice that the wheels are not aligned it could be due to damage by collisions or bumps. Additionally, it's essential to examine connectors and wires for wear and wear and tear. They are easily damaged by vibration or extreme heat, resulting in a malfunction or even electrical malfunctions. It is also recommended to keep spare batteries on hand in the event of an emergency. If your batteries are not charged, you'll soon find that they're not working and you will struggle to move your chair. A new battery set are available if required and then placed inside the frame of your chair to make it easy to access. If you're planning to travel with your electric chair, think about buying a sling or carry bag to provide additional security. They're readily available from a wide range of mobility stores and can be ordered on the internet. These are also great for boarding a plane or using public transportation.
